Keys and Locks

You are issued at least one key when you sign your lease. Families generally receive two keys. Single students each receive one key. Extra keys for family members are available from the office. Each key opens the main apartment door and mailbox. Keys are numbered with the apartment number and a key number (from 1–4). When you move out, the same number of keys with the same key numbers must be returned as were issued.

When single students are transferring/switching apartments they are sometimes tempted to exchange keys with the outgoing roommate instead of turning them into the office. However, this is not the proper procedure. All keys must be returned and picked up at the office.

If you lose a key, both the apartment and mailbox locks are changed, new keys are issued and you will be charged to cover the replacement cost. (Locks are also changed and the fee is assessed if all keys are not returned when the apartment is vacated.) You may not install your own locks or dead bolts on the main apartment door or on individual bedroom doors.

Lockouts

You may find yourself in the unfortunate position of being locked out of your apartment. For assistance during normal business hours call the resident manager. If he/she is not available come to the WMU Apartments Office and borrow a spare key. On weekends and after 8:00 p.m. contact WMU Public Safety at 387-5555.

For your protection, identification such as name, social security number, birth dates, etc., is required for assistance. We do not unlock doors for children. Only those adults listed on your lease will be assisted.

Resident Parking

All motor vehicles (cars, motorcycles, etc.) must be registered and parked in a lot designated by the permit. The permit is free when you register your vehicle at Parking Services during regular business hours, 7:30 a.m.–5 p.m., Monday through Friday, and can be used only for your particular apartment complex. They will require your identification, State-issued vehicle registration and apartment lease. Only residents listed on the lease are eligible for a permit.

In the Goldsworth Valley area, each apartment has an assigned parking place. Second and third cars must be parked in lot #77, at the end of building "R."

Self Paint Program

A "self-paint" program is available if you wish to paint your apartment walls. The university provides all paint, rollers, brushes, etc. Since WMU is not able to paint all vacant apartments, it is possible an apartment may need painting when you move in.

Please note: You must make necessary arrangements through the WMU Apartments Office prior to painting.

Storage Areas

Storage areas are a shared space for WMU Apartment residents for small items such as boxes of seasonal clothing. They are NOT designed to store furniture, automobile tires, or other large items. In order to provide an organized, clean storage area, as well as to improve security for items in storage rooms, the rooms are accessible only through the resident manager (from 8 a.m.–8 p.m.) or the WMU Apartments Office (Monday–Friday, 8 a.m.–5 p.m.). Identification stickers, indicating your name, apartment number and date you are placing items in storage are also available when you check out the key to your storage area.
